ABBREVIATIONS - K Knit - P Purl - K2tog Knit next two stitches together - Sl1 Slip next stitch onto needle - Psso Pass slipped stitch over next knitted stitch - StSt Stocking stitch (Knit 1 row, Purl 1 row) - Garter Stitch K every row - Cast off Cast off stitches using K unless specified otherwise - Kfb Knit front and back - For Reindeer: o SC Single crochet MATERIALS - Santa: Pink or Peach wool; White wool; Red wool; Black wool - Snowman: White wool; Any colour wool for Hat & Bobble; Orange wool; Black wool - Reindeer: Medium Brown wool; Dark Brown wool; White wool; Red wool; Black wool - For Santa & Snowman: 3mm Needles; 2.5cm Safety Pin (Optional); Small amount of Toy Stuffing; Tapestry Needle - For Reindeer: 1.75 Crochet Hook; Tapestry Needle; Small amount of Toy Stuffing
2 SANTA Head & Hat: - Using Pink or Peach, cast on 12 sts, leaving a long enough end for sewing up the back seam. - Row 1: K1, (K twice into next st) x 10, K1 (22 sts) - Rows 2-6: Beginning with a P row, StSt for 5 rows - Change to White for edging on hat. - Rows 7-10: K (garter stitch) - Change to Red for hat. - Row 11-14: Beginning with a K row, StSt for 4 rows. - Row 15: K3, Sl1, K1, Psso, K2tog, K3, Sl1, K1, Psso, K2tog, K3 (17 sts). - Row 16: P2tog (x4), P1, P2tog (x4) (9 sts) - Draw wool through sts leaving loose. - Cut off wool leaving a long end for closing up and option to sew on safety pin later. Eyes & Nose: - Eyes: Using Black, work 2 straight sts over the 10 th and 13 th sts on the last row of Santa s face, immediately below the garter st edging of Santa s hat. Tie off ends tightly at back. - Nose: Using Red, work 2 straight sts centrally between eyes but 3 rows below garter st edging. To make up: - Gather cast on sts and pull up tightly. Over sew firmly to close. - Using backstitch and keeping continuity of colour, sew up back seam, then lightly stuff with toy stuffing. - Pull up the loose sts at top of Hat tightly and over sew firmly. - Take wool through back of work to second row of hat (above garter st edging) - Over sew fixed arm of safety pin in place centrally. Hat Bobble: - Using White, cast on 12 sts. - Row 1: P (this is the right side) - Cast off using K. - With right side on the outside, roll up the work from one short edge to the other. - Over sew the short edge to the rolled up work. - Gather the cast off edge and pull up tightly. Over sew edges to close end. - Gather the cast on edge and pull up tightly then sew top of hat. Santa s Beard - Using White, cast on 2 sts. - Working garter st throughout, K 7 rows increasing 1 st at each end of every row (16 sts) - Row 8-9: K - Row 10: K1, K2tog (x7), K1 (9 sts) - Cast off. - Sew beard onto face along cast off edge and side of last 2 rows, beginning and ending 2 rows below garter st edging of hat and forming a curve below Santa s nose.
3 SNOWMAN Head: - Using White, cast on 12 sts, leaving a long enough end for sewing up the back seam. - Row 1: K1, K twice into next st (x10), K1 (22 sts) - Rows 2-6: Beginning with a P row, StSt for 5 rows - Change to colour for Hat. - Rows 7-10: K (garter stitch) - Rows 11-14: Beginning with a K row, StSt for 4 rows. - Row 15: K3, S1, K1, Psso, K2tog, K3, K2tog, K3, S1, K1, Psso, K2tog, K3 (17 sts) - Row 16: P2tog (x4), P1, P2tog (x4), (9sts) - Drw wool through sts leaving loose. - Cut off wool leaving a long end for closing up and option to sew on safety pin later. Eyes: - Using Black, work 2 straight sts over the 10 th and 13 th sts on the last row of Snowman s face, immediately below the garter st edging of the hat. - Tie off ends tightly at back of work. To make up: - Gather cast on sts and pull up tightly. Over sew. - Using backstitch and keeping continuity of colour, sew up back seam, then lightly stuff with toy stuffing. Pull up the loose sts at top of Hat tightly and over sew firmly. - Take wool through back of work to second row of hat (above garter st edging) - Over sew fixed arm of safety pin in place centrally. Hat Bobble: - Using same colour as hat, cast on 12 sts - Row 1: P (this is the right side) - Row 2: K - Cast off using K - With right side on the outside, roll uo the work from one side to the other. - Over sew the short edge to the rolled up work. - Gather the cast off edge and pull up tightly. - Over sew edges to close end. - Gather up the cast on edge and pull up tightly then sew to top hat. Nose: - Using Orange, cast on 6 sts. - Row 1: Sl1, K1, Psso, K2tog (x2), (3 sts) - Draw wool through sts and pull tightly to fasten off. - Over sew row edges. - Place nose centrally between eyes, over 3 rd and 4 th row below garter st edging of Hat and over sew cast on edge to Snowman s face.
4 REINDEER Face - Using Medium Brown, cast on 9 sts. - Row 1: K1, (Kfb, K1) to end - Row 2: P - Row 3: K1, (Kfb, K1) to end - Row 4: P12 Brown, P1 White, P12 Brown - Row 5: K11 Brown, K3 White, K11 Brown - Row 6: P10 Brown, P5 White, P10 Brown - Row 7: K11 Brown, K3 White, K11 Brown - Row 8: P12 Brown, P1 White, P12 Brown - Row 9: Using Brown, K1, (K2tog, K4) to end - Row 10: P - Row 11: K - Row 12: P - Row 13: K1, (K2tog, K3) to end - Row 14: P - Row 15: K1, (K2tog) to end - Draw together and sew back, lightly stuff with toy stuffing Ears: - Using Medium Brown cast on 9 sts - Cast off - Fold in half and sew seam - Sew onto either side of head Antlers (make 2) (optional): - Using Dark Brown make 2 short pieces: o 1: Magic ring, sc 4 o 2-5: sc 4 o Fasten off with long thread. - Again using Dark Brown make 2 long pieces: o 1: Magic ring, sc 4 o 2-8: sc 4 o Fasten off with long thread. - Sew the shorter piece to the longer piece as shown to make antler shape. Repeat for second antler.
